在当今互联网的世界中,代理服务器成为了一个不可或缺的工具。无论是在企业环境中还是个人使用中,代理服务器的应用场景不断扩大,那么,代理服务器的主要作用究竟是什么呢?

1. 网络请求的中介

代理服务器最基本的作用是作为网络请求的中介。它接受来自用户的请求,然后作为用户,向目标服务器发送请求,最后将目标服务器的响应返回给用户。这一过程可以隐藏用户的真实IP地址,保护用户的隐私。同时,这也有助于提高网络请求的效率,减少不必要的网络流量。

1.1 隐私保护

由于代理服务器能够掩盖用户的真实IP地址,它在隐私保护方面发挥了关键作用。在访问某些网站时,用户的真实身份可能会被暴露,这不仅带来隐私风险,也可能接收到不必要的跟踪。因此,通过代理服务器,用户可以隐藏自己的身份,避免网络监控和数据收集。

1.2 降低延迟

使用代理服务器还可以降低网络请求的延迟。许多代理服务器能够在本地缓存常用的网站数据,当用户再次访问这些网站时,代理服务器能够直接从缓存中返回数据,减少了访问时间,提高了浏览速度。

2. 访问控制与审计

在企业环境中,代理服务器还被广泛用于访问控制和审计。企业通常会通过代理服务器来监管员工的互联网使用,确保符合公司的政策和规定。

2.1 内容过滤

代理服务器可以设定规则,过滤不当内容。这对于企业而言,能够有效阻止员工访问不相关的网站,例如社交媒体和成人内容。这不仅提高了工作效率,还有助于降低网络安全风险。

2.2 审计与监控

企业可以通过代理服务器记录所有的网络请求,从而生成详细的审计日志。这些日志可以用来监控员工的行为,确保网络使用符合公司的政策。同时,在出现网络安全事件时,这些日志也能帮助调查和追溯事件的源头。

3. 提高安全性

代理服务器在提高网络安全性方面也扮演了重要角色。通过各种配置,代理服务器能够为内部网络提供额外的保护。

3.1 防火墙作用

代理服务器可以充当防火墙,阻止来自外部网络的恶意攻击和不必要的连接。通过设定规则,代理服务器能够过滤所有入站和出站的流量,从而保护企业的内部网络安全。

3.2 加密与身份验证

某些代理服务器支持数据加密功能,能够将用户与目标服务器之间的通信数据加密,增添了一层安全保障。此外,代理服务器也可以要求用户进行身份验证,以确保只有授权用户才能访问网络资源。

4. 绕过地理限制

在某些情况下,用户可能会遇到地理区域限制。例如,一些流媒体服务只在特定地区提供内容。代理服务器能够帮助用户绕过这些限制,访问全球的内容。

4.1 加速内容访问

通过选择不同地区的代理服务器,用户可以获得更快的内容访问速度。某些内容在特定国家的服务器访问速度可能较慢,通过代理服务器,用户可以选择更接近目标服务器的代理,提高访问效率。

4.2 访问受限网站

许多国家或地区对某些网站进行了限制,用户无法直接访问。使用代理服务器可以通过切换到允许访问的地区,成功访问这些网站。这使得用户能够获得更多的信息资源,拓展网络体验。

5. 负载均衡

在网络流量较大的情况下,代理服务器还可以用于负载均衡。通过分配不同的网络请求到不同的服务器,代理服务器能够有效地减少单一服务器的负担,确保网络的稳定性和可靠性。

5.1 避免拥堵

在访问高峰期间,单一服务器可能会遭遇流量拥堵,导致响应时间变慢。使用代理服务器,网络请求能够被合理分配,避免了拥堵现象,从而提高了整体用户体验。

5.2 提升可用性

通过设置多个代理服务器,企业可以在一台服务器出现故障时,自动将流量转向其他可用代理,确保网络服务的持续可用性。这大大提高了企业的网络稳定性。

代理服务器的主要作用包括网络请求的中介、访问控制与审计、安全性提高、绕过地理限制及负载均衡等多个方面。在多样化的使用场景中,代理服务器毫无疑问已成为优化网络体验和增强安全性的重要工具。无论是个人用户还是企业,都能从代理服务器的功能中获益。